随着信息技术的快速发展,服务器的性能与状态监控已成为企业和组织不可或缺的一部分。高效的监控不仅能提升系统的可靠性,还能在故障发生之前及时预警,从而减少损失。本文将深入探讨如何高效监控和管理自己的服务器性能与状态,重点工具的选择、指标的设定、报警机制的建立以及优化策略的制定。
选择合适的监控工具是高效管理服务器性能的基础。目前市场上有多种监控工具可供选择,如Zabbix、Prometheus、Nagios等。这些工具各有特点,用户应根据自身的需求和资源情况进行选择。例如,Zabbix适合大规模环境的监控,而Prometheus则以其强大的数据处理能力和灵活性受到开发者的青睐。在选择时,还应考虑工具的易用性、社区支持和可扩展性等因素。
设定监控指标是监控工作的重要环节。常见的监控指标包括CPU使用率、内存使用量、磁盘I/O、网络流量等。通过实时监控这些关键指标,管理员可以全面了解服务器的运行状态。同时,合理的指标设定不仅能帮助及时发现问题,还能为后续的性能优化提供依据。管理员应定期审查和更新监控指标,以确保其与业务需求的变化保持一致。
在监测到异常数据时,及时的报警机制至关重要。报警机制的设定应基于实际情况,避免过多无用警报引起的警报疲劳。在设定报警阈值时,可以参考历史数据和业务负载情况,根据实际经验进行调整。一旦监测到系统性能下降或故障,报警系统应能及时通知相关人员,并提供必要的故障信息,以便于快速定位问题。
优化策略的制定是确保服务器性能长期稳定的重要措施。对监控数据的分析,能够帮助管理者识别出性能瓶颈与潜在风险。例如,若CPU使用率长期处于高位,可能需要考虑增加硬件资源或优化应用程序的代码。对于内存使用率过高的情况,可以检查是否存在内存泄漏,并进行相应的修复。定期进行服务器维护,如清理日志文件、更新软件和补丁等,也能有效提升服务器的性能稳定性。
除了以上提到的策略,还有一些先进的方法可以进一步管理的效果。例如,利用人工智能(AI)和机器学习(ML)技术进行数据分析,可以帮助生成更智能的预测模型,从而提前识别出潜在的性能问题。近年来,越来越多的企业开始尝试将这些新技术应用于服务器监控工作中,以期提升管理效率和系统可靠性。
高效监控与管理服务器性能与状态是一个系统化的过程,涉及工具选择、指标设定、报警机制和优化策略的全面考虑。随着技术的不断进步,监控手段也在不断演变,企业应保持对新技术的敏感性,以便更好地应对日益复杂的监控需求。通过不断优化监控管理策略,企业可以在激烈的市场竞争中保持优势,确保其IT基础设施的高效运行。